What is an Orangery?


To kick things off, it's crucial to comprehend what makes an orangery distinct from other types of extensions. An orangery is a brick-built structure, generally with big glass windows and a glass roofing system, developed to bring the outdoors in. Historically, these extensions were used to cultivate citrus fruits in cool environments. Today, they function as brilliant and welcoming areas for relaxation, celebrations, or perhaps as practical rooms for activities such as dining or gardening.

The Benefits of an Orangery Extension


1. Enhanced Natural Light

Among the defining functions of an orangery is its capability to flood an area with natural light. The large windows and glass roofing system develop a pleasant environment, minimizing the reliance on synthetic lighting.

2. Increasing Property Value

Home improvements tend to increase residential or commercial property worth, and an orangery is no exception. Prospective purchasers are frequently drawn to the sophistication and added area, making it a worthy financial investment.

3. Versatile Usage

Orangeries can be developed to match a range of functions. Whether your requirements lean toward a family room, an extra dining location, or perhaps an office, the versatility of orangeries makes them perfect.

4. Connection to Nature

Designed to blur the line between inside and outdoors, orangeries encourage homeowners to get in touch with their surroundings. This natural visual can supply psychological health advantages, too.

5. Customizable Design

Unlike conventional extensions, orangeries permit imaginative design choices. Property owners can pick their preferred products, colors, and layouts to ensure the brand-new space harmonizes with the existing home.

Q3: Are orangeries energy-efficient?

Modern orangeries can be built with energy-efficient glass and insulation to decrease heat loss, making them a viable alternative for all-season enjoyment.
